Exquisite Pizza Sauce

Reviewed: May 7, 2010
Fantastic pizza sauce. I only had tomato sauce on hand so I converted it to paste by pouring it into a pan, and heating until It reduced by half. While it was heating I put all of the other ingrediants to simmer with the sauce. It turned out really great. I used the "Pizza Dough I" recipe from this site and it complimented the sauce very well. I will be making this again and again. Thank you, Angie for your recipe.

Downeast Maine Pumpkin Bread

Reviewed: Dec. 22, 2009
Fabulous, fabulous, fabulous! I made some modifications to suit our tastes better. Here's what I did. I used half wheat flour half white flour; apple juice instead of water; half white sugar half brown sugar; half oil half apple sauce. I also added 1 cup chopped walnuts. This was perfect! Thai-Style Peanut Sauce with Honey

Reviewed: Aug. 27, 2009
I made two batches. One for those who don't like spicey (leaving out the chilis) and one for others who like spicey. I also mixed it up using our Vita-Mix blender. Using the blender worked out great because it cooked the sauce a little bit and made it very smooth so much so that it almost looked like caramel. Pumpkin Gingerbread

Reviewed: Jan. 5, 2005
This is a wonderful recipe as is. However, I took the advise of a few others and used some substitutions... I used apple cider instead of water, substituted 1 cup brown sugar for white, used 1 cup whole wheat flour for white and omitted the allspice (just because I didn't have any at the time) but doubled the ginger, cinnamon and cloves.
